How it feels
A gay man decides to tell his three brothers that he is gay. He navigates their reactions and keeps the secret from his father.

What happens
Outing Riley is a 2004 comedy film about a gay man coming out to his three brothers written, directed, and starring Pete Jones. It was screened at the 2004 Chicago International Film Festival and released on video in 2007. The movie was subsequently renamed If Dad Only Knew. (from Wikipedia, CC BY-SA)
